JLG began in 1969, when our founder, John L. Grove set out to resolve growing safety concerns in the construction industry. Since then we have been committed to understanding the challenges and delivering innovative solutions to the access market. We partner with customers to provide quality equipment, training opportunities and trusted support within the access industry. We are a global company, and our products—including mobile elevating work platforms, telehandlers, utility vehicles and accessories—can be found all over the world. Reporting to the Sr. Director of Global Manufacturing Engineering, the Director of Innovative Manufacturing leads global manufacturing innovation across the Access Segment. This role is responsible for identifying, developing, and deploying advanced manufacturing, automation, digital, and analytics capabilities that strengthen operational performance and shape the future manufacturing footprint through close partnership with operations, engineering, DT, and external technology partners. YOUR IMPACT Manage the innovation efforts that identify strategies, business opportunities, and new technologies; then focus on developing new capabilities Leader that focuses on ideation, problem solving, and benchmarking key technology trends Demonstrate leadership to provide strategy, vision, and direction to global manufacturing team Evaluate technologies from suppliers and R&D organizations Drive strategic manufacturing innovation and lead Technology Creation Process (TCP) Stay on top of external industry developments and best practices Support teams to develop manufacturing innovation roadmap that will introduce new technologies to global footprint Analyze new advanced manufacturing trends and techniques, automation, robotics, and assembly tools seeking opportunities to transfer technologies from R&D to the manufacturing facilities. Support a team that works closely with the Manufacturing, DT, and Design Engineering,. Support teams that design digital solutions for our manufacturing plants Manage analytics teams to design applications and dashboards to capture product and process data, predict outcomes, and prescribe solutions in manufacturing. Grow AI and machine learning capabilities within the organization and utilize data analytics to improve process quality. Promote collaboration with Design Engineering and become embedded with product design to implement DFM principles; identify key metrics to measure DFM success Develop innovation goals, design project charters, and update leadership on project status. Manage relationships with various third-party suppliers and R&D institutes Provide guidance and leadership on equipment specifications and standards Assign projects, tasks, and support responsibilities to team members. Guide and coach team members to achievement of goals. High performance individual that manages Innovation group focused on automation, digital technologies, advanced analytics, and DFM Development of the innovation, footprint, strategy team to develop automation with the future footprint of JLG.
